A search API has been created. The Backend and the SmartAPI has been modified to support the search functionalities. A search recieves a series as a parameter, one that do not necessarily specifies a unit. Similar to a workflow, a search type is defined per domain. Moreover, a 'options' parameter is also expected, specifying which type of search will be performed. If options is not presented, search of index 0 will be executed. A search returns a multi-unit series, ordered by timestamp. An example for tutorial domain is provided, where through search0 anomalous temperature values are detected in the space-time range specified by the series parameter.

A whole response json can be too large to be handled as an argument to a workflow call. Thus we decided to inform the parameters with a buffer file to be read by the workflow. Also, as previously discussed, the series workflow is not used as a filter during data querying. It is used to process the data before responding to the client.
